The Variables: Network Difficulty and the Halving Matrix

The underlying mechanics governing token distribution rely heavily on thermodynamic security and competitive difficulty balancing.
When evaluating bitcoin mining profitability, you are competing globally against millions of secondary machines for a fixed portion of daily block rewards.
Because the network automatically adjusts its cryptographic difficulty every 2,016 blocks, a simple arithmetic projection will fail. This simulator integrates live baseline
difficulty parameters along with post-halving reward constants (3.125 BTC per block), providing high-fidelity revenue forecasting based on realistic block-space physics.

Optimizing Performance via Local Utility Tariffs

Hardware hashing metrics only tell half the story; real sustainability is determined by your operational utility expenses.
Experienced data center managers always calculate mining returns by electricity costs because electricity functions as a constant, non-negotiable cash drain.
A high-hashrate machine that consumes excessive wattage can easily trigger net negative returns if deployed in a high-tariff energy grid. By using this online
asic breakeven calculator, you can cross-reference equipment hardware costs against your local kilowatt-hour (kWh) rates to pinpoint the exact month your operation transitions into pure profit.
